Steve Madden vs. Michael Kors: A Detailed Look

Both Michael Kors and Steve Madden have built empires on offering stylish accessories and footwear at relatively affordable prices. This accessibility has contributed to their widespread popularity, making them household names for many consumers. However, their approaches differ significantly. Steve Madden, known for its bold designs and often edgy aesthetic, frequently incorporates current trends into its collections. Their designs, while sometimes drawing inspiration from other brands, often have a distinctive, recognizable style that leans towards a younger, more fashion-forward demographic. They're less about subtle luxury and more about immediate impact and trend-driven appeal.

Michael Kors, on the other hand, initially positioned itself as a more sophisticated, slightly elevated alternative to fast fashion. While the price point remains accessible, the brand aimed for a more polished and timeless aesthetic, at least in its earlier years. The brand's signature logo was heavily featured, contributing to its widespread recognition, but also becoming a point of contention as we will explore later. Michael Kors' collections often incorporate classic silhouettes with contemporary updates, aiming for a blend of style and practicality. However, like Steve Madden, accusations of design mimicry have followed the brand throughout its trajectory.

Why the Hate for Michael Kors? Exploring the Reddit Thread and Beyond

The Reddit thread, "Why the hate for Michael Kors? : r/handbags," provides valuable insight into the often-negative perception of the Michael Kors brand. Several recurring themes emerge from the discussion. One of the most prominent criticisms centers on the brand's perceived overuse of its logo and the association with “logo-mania” of the early 2010s. The saturation of the market with heavily logoed Michael Kors bags created a sense of overexposure and, for some, a feeling of the brand lacking originality. The constant visibility of the logo, while initially a strong branding strategy, ultimately contributed to the brand's association with mass-market appeal and a decline in perceived exclusivity. Many commenters express a preference for more understated luxury brands, where quality and design are prioritized over overt branding.
